AI Summary

Alpha Cognition Inc. filed its definitive proxy statement (DEF 14A) on April 30, 2025, for its annual meeting on June 19, 2025. The company, formerly known as Neurodyn Cognition Inc., is seeking shareholder approval for matters related to its corporate governance and operations. The filing provides details on executive compensation, director nominations, and other proposals requiring shareholder votes.

What is the purpose of a DEF 14A filing?

A DEF 14A filing is a definitive proxy statement filed by a company with the SEC, providing shareholders with information they need to vote on matters at an upcoming shareholder meeting.
